$0.00

Details

A000013180 - Toshiba 17-inch WSXGA+ 1680X1050 LCD Laptop Screen

Reviews

You're reviewing:

A000013180 - Toshiba 17-inch WSXGA+ 1680X1050 LCD Laptop Screen